The Office of the City Manager is responsible for executing the policies adopted by the City Council. The City Manager’s office provides for the general management of the City and is responsible for personnel, compensation and benefits administration, labor relations, risk management, long-range planning, maintenance of official records, licensing, policy research and implementation, human relations, elections, staffing of the Housing and Redevelopment Authority, employee training and career development, management of City facilities and computer network support.

The City Council is currently in the process of hiring a new City Manager to succeed Gordon Hughes, who retired July 30. PDI Ninth House is leading the hiring process.
